def setup_dpdk(install_path, eni_dbdf, eni_ethdev):
    logger.debug("setup_dpdk: install_path=%s" % (install_path))

    if os.path.exists(install_path) == False:
        logger.error("install_path=%s does not exist." % (install_path))
        logger.error("Please specify a directory that was installed via virtual-ethernet-pktgen-install.py, exiting")
        sys.exit(1)

    if eni_dbdf == "None" or eni_ethdev == "None":
        logger.error("eni_dbdf=%s, eni_ethdev=%s is invalid, exiting" % (eni_dbdf, eni_ethdev))
        sys.exit(1)

    if eni_ethdev == "eth0":
        logger.error("Using eni_ethdev=%s for pktgen will disrupt your primary network interface" % (eni_ethdev))
        logger.error("Please specifiy a different eni_ethdev such as eth1, exiting")
        sys.exit(1)

    # Stash away the current working directory
    cwd = os.getcwd()
    scripts_path = os.path.dirname(os.path.abspath(sys.argv[0]))
    logger.debug("scripts directory path is %s" % (scripts_path))

    # cd to the install_path/dpdk directory
    os.chdir("%s/dpdk" % (install_path))

    if os.path.exists(dpdk_devbind) == False:
        logger.error("dpdk_devbind=%s does not exist." % (dpdk_devbind))
        logger.error("Please specify a directory that was installed via virtual-ethernet-pktgen-install.py, exiting")
        sys.exit(1)

    # Mount '/mnt/huge', if needed
    if os.path.exists("/mnt/huge") == False:
        cmd_exec("mkdir /mnt/huge")

    cmd_exec("mount -t hugetlbfs nodev /mnt/huge")

    # Configure hugepages
    cmd_exec("echo %d > /sys/kernel/mm/hugepages/hugepages-2048kB/nr_hugepages" % (num_2MB_hugepages))

    # Load distro-specific uio
    load_uio()

    # Remove then load igb_uio.ko
    cmd_exec("rmmod ./build/kernel/linux/igb_uio/igb_uio.ko >/dev/null 2>&1", False)
    cmd_exec("insmod ./build/kernel/linux/igb_uio/igb_uio.ko")

    # Bind the ENI device to to DPDK
    cmd_exec("ip link set %s down" % (eni_ethdev))
    cmd_exec("python3 %s --bind=igb_uio %s" % (dpdk_devbind, eni_dbdf))

    # cd back to the original directory
    os.chdir("%s" % (cwd))

    # Print a success message
    print_success(scripts_path, install_path)
